Boston police investigate officer's death, suspect suicide
By Kathy McCabe and Ralph Ranalli
The Boston Globe
BOSTON — A young Boston police officer fatally shot herself inside her South Boston apartment last night, a police official said.
Police shut down most of East Sixth Street for much of the evening near the duplex where the shooting occurred but did not release any details or confirm the identity of the officer.
"We are investigating a death," was all that Superintendent in Chief Robert P. Dunford would say at the scene.
Another police official, speaking on condition of anonymity, confirmed that the victim of the self-inflicted gunshot wound was a young woman who had been on the force for a relatively short time.
Police received a call about the shooting at 8:42 p.m.
A number of top officials from the Boston Police Department visited the scene last night, including Commissioner Edward F. Davis, who comforted and shook hands with officers and investigators.
